Output 0107963571e8cbffba7fa184919c2b60c49233a8005628f4fb8dacae9142c546:42

value
210615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 647ff5f417a44e264bfae4878d99a59d51169748 OP_EQUAL
address
3ArQnbX7osaeDj3QcdGiWyy25eczrD9y2T
transaction
0107963571e8cbffba7fa184919c2b60c49233a8005628f4fb8dacae9142c546
spent
true